Understanding Skunk Odor

Before delving into the effectiveness of air purifiers, it is crucial to comprehend the nature of skunk odor. Skunk spray contains several volatile sulfur compounds, notably thiols, which are responsible for the distinctive and overwhelming smell. These compounds have low molecular weights, making them highly volatile and easily dispersed in the air. Consequently, removing skunk smell becomes challenging due to its persistence and ability to permeate different surfaces.

How Air Purifiers Work

Air purifiers are devices designed to improve indoor air quality by removing various airborne pollutants, allergens, and odors. They utilize different mechanisms, including filtration, ionization, and oxidation, to achieve this goal. The most common type of air purifier is the mechanical filter-based purifier, which employs a fan to draw air through filters that capture particles of different sizes.

Filtration and Skunk Odor Removal

Mechanical filter-based air purifiers, equipped with high-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filters, are known for their effectiveness in capturing tiny particles, including odor-causing compounds. While HEPA filters are not specifically designed to target odors, they can trap airborne particles as small as 0.3 microns with an efficiency of 99.97%. This includes many of the skunk odor-causing molecules, providing a means of reducing the smell within an enclosed space.

Activated Carbon Filters and Odor Elimination

Activated carbon filters, often used in conjunction with HEPA filters, play a vital role in removing odors. These filters contain activated charcoal, a highly porous substance that adsorbs and traps odor molecules. The large surface area of activated carbon enables it to capture and retain volatile organic compounds (VOCs), including the sulfur compounds present in skunk spray. This mechanism can significantly contribute to eliminating the skunk smell when incorporated into an air purifier.

Limitations of Air Purifiers

While air purifiers can be effective tools in reducing skunk odor, it is essential to acknowledge their limitations. Skunk smell can permeate various surfaces, including furniture, carpets, and walls. Air purifiers primarily target airborne particles, and while they can capture some odor molecules, they may not completely eliminate the smell embedded in porous materials. Therefore, a comprehensive approach that combines air purification with additional cleaning and deodorizing methods may be necessary for complete skunk odor removal.

Additional Techniques for Skunk Odor Removal

To enhance the effectiveness of air purifiers, consider employing supplementary techniques for skunk odor removal. Here are some recommendations:

  • Ventilation: Increase air circulation by opening windows and doors to allow fresh air to enter the space, facilitating the removal of skunk odor.
  • Deep Cleaning: Clean affected surfaces thoroughly using appropriate cleaning agents to remove skunk spray residue and minimize lingering odor.
  • Odor Neutralizers: Utilize odor neutralizing products or natural remedies such as vinegar, baking soda, or activated charcoal to absorb and neutralize the skunk smell.
  • Professional Services: In severe cases, consider seeking professional services specializing in odor removal, as they have access to advanced equipment and techniques tailored for stubborn odors.
